Abstract
"This anthology presents the voices of aboriginal people and includes genre ranging from traditional myths, legends and poetry to memoirs, biography and contemporary literature. It is a survey of Native literature from traditional times to the present. Readers can learn from these aboriginal voices as they add their "bit of truth" to a body of Canadian writing which, all too often, has ignored them. Selections in this anthology may be sad, angry, passionate, satirical or humorous but they are never boring.
Brief discussions of the various genre, information on the authors and some explanations of the excerpts make this an invaluable book for schools and classrooms who wish to incorporate aboriginal literature into their programs."--Back cover.
